Helping Pure Earth fight pollution We created a Report Pollution app for Pure Earth, an NGO that has been solving pollution problems in low- and middle-income countries for the last 20 years. Our app is designed to document and report polluted sites that users have direct contact with. Report Pollution aims to become a platform for underrepresented communities and help them inspire others to take action and raise awareness. Read more about the project here. Netguru x Coalition for Rainforest Nations In December 2019, the Coalition launched REDD.plus, the first platform to provide a central registry and exchange of RRU credits. This is a milestone achievement in scaling up the fight to reduce carbon emissions, and we’re proud that our team has been instrumental in this initiative.

Inclusive design Inclusive design is design that is accessible and understandable by anyone. Last year, we launched a free set of 59 inclusive avatars. This was just one of our small steps towards creating inclusive digital products for diverse audiences. You can find more information here. CULTURE BOOK
